History of Snowflake Pattern Sweaters

The concept of snowflakes as a design element in knitwear is not new. Snowflake patterns have been a winter wonderland staple for decades, with early examples dating back to the early 18th century. Initially inspired by nature's intricate designs, these snowflake motifs have evolved over the years to become a symbol of cozy comfort and nostalgia. In recent years, the resurgence of the snowflake pattern sweater has seen a renewed interest from designers and consumers alike, making them a staple in winter wardrobes.

Tips and Tricks for Styling Snowflake Pattern Sweaters

- Mix and Match: Pair a snowflake pattern sweater with a casual pair of jeans for the perfect winter look that's infinitely adaptable.
- Layering: Layering is a game-changer, especially with snowflake sweaters, as the volume of textures and patterns creates a warm, rich look.
- Monochrome Dreams: Create a zero-to-hero look by pairing a snowflake sweater with complementary monotone accessories, like black trousers and boots.
